Nucode
Category: AI Infrastructure
Nucode provides a total AIoT development ecosystem consisting of pre-certified, ultra-low power 'NU-Modules' and a no-code/low-code development workspace 'NU-Works' to simplify the manufacturing of smart devices. Nucode was founded in 2024. The company is led by Gwanhyeong Lee. Based in Seoul, South Korea. Team size: 1-10. Total funding raised: Undisclosed. Latest round: Grant (2025) - AI development platform; last VC was Seed. Key investors include Korea Investment Accelerator, Ministry of SMEs and Startups (TIPS).

Value proposition
Democratizes IoT manufacturing by reducing the technical barrier to hardware development and shortening time-to-market through pre-certified modules and an easy-to-use programming environment.
Products and solutions
NU-Module Series (NU40 DK, NU-54 Bluetooth 5.4 Module), NU-Works (No-code/Low-code IDE and Workspace for MCU/RTOS), NU-Combo (On-device AI & high-speed video transmission module), MQTT-based low-power hardware solutions, AIoT Development Wiki & Documentation platform
Unique value
Unlike traditional embedded development which requires deep C/C++ and hardware knowledge, Nucode offers a 'no-code' approach specifically for MCU and RTOS-based systems, combined with high-performance on-device AI.
Target customer
IoT device manufacturers, smart hardware startups, software developers entering the hardware market, and enterprise IoT solution providers.
Industries served
Smart Home & Security, Industrial IoT (IIoT), Smart Mobility, Wearable Devices, Smart City Infrastructure
Technology advantage
Proprietary integration of ultra-low power communication protocols (BLE 5.4, WiFi 6E, Matter, Thread) with on-device AI; Modules come with pre-obtained global certifications (KC, FCC, CE) to facilitate immediate export.
How they differentiate
Bridges the gap between no-code software and mass-producible hardware via 'NU-Works' (a low-code IDE for MCU/RTOS) and pre-certified modules (KC, FCC, CE) that eliminate the typical 6-month certification delay.

Major milestones
Founded in June 2024 by serial entrepreneur Gwanhyeong Lee, Selected for 'Barun Donghaeng' 5th Batch by Korea Investment Accelerator (Sep 2024), Won the Presidential Award at the 2024 Radio Broadcasting Technology Awards, Selected for the TIPS program by the Ministry of SMEs and Startups (Dec 2024), Announced mass production and participation in CES 2026 conference

About Gwanhyeong Lee
Serial entrepreneur in the IoT and hardware sector. He was the Founder and CEO of Cheese Coconut (주식회사 치즈코코넛), an IoT startup that developed smart home security devices. He has extensive expertise in low-power communication protocols (BLE, Wi-Fi 6E, Zigbee, Matter) and on-device AI hardware integration.
